Behavior Interventions (BII) is offering an intensive 4-week training program to become a Registered Behavior Technician (RBT). This program enhances knowledge and experience in the field of Applied Behavior Analysis (ABA), working directly with clients with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D) and other developmental delays. The training includes online webinars, role-play, competency-based practice, and direct observation of services. Upon completion, trainees will have the necessary requirements to schedule their RBT exam, making them eligible for a pay increase and more case options. BII, founded in 2006, specializes in ABA services for individuals aged 18 months to 21 years with ASD, communication and developmental delays, and challenging behaviors, serving Delaware, Central and Southeastern Pennsylvania, and New Jersey. BII is committed to employee career development through training, clinical supervision, and guidance for certifications.
